Output 74dfa58551543b1179dcda71854624a0e29a3a1525083b3875913395e43671fe:10

value
10349200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3cc49d1c0e3eee82903680e618a34b052c1c462 OP_EQUAL
address
3Gd6o1t2kJsuCtKaGhVKSrDvfB9HcAaFvS
transaction
74dfa58551543b1179dcda71854624a0e29a3a1525083b3875913395e43671fe
spent
true